When it comes to your bariatric journey, curiosity isn’t just a nice trait, it’s a game-changer. Instead of judging a choice, a feeling, or a setback, curiosity invites you to notice what’s happening with kindness and without shame.

Curiosity sounds like:

  • “Why might my body be asking for this right now?”
  • “What can I learn from this moment?”
  • “How could I support myself differently next time?”

This gentle shift helps turn guilt into growth, fear into clarity, and confusion into confidence. And the best part? You can start being curious at any point in your journey, no perfect timing required.
